心脏不停跳或停跳体外循环对血浆电解质和酸碱平衡影响  

The Influence on the Plasma Electrolyte and Acid-base Balance by CPB With Beating Heart or Arrested Heart

摘  要:目的 :探讨心脏不停跳或心脏停跳体外循环对血浆电解质和酸碱平衡的影响。方法 :随机选择 93例瓣膜置换心内直视手术患者 ,4 7例采用心脏不停跳体外循环 (BH组 ) ,4 6例采用心脏停跳体外循环 (AH组 ) ,在 CPB中监测平均动脉压、中心静脉压、尿量、鼻咽温 ,并在转前、转机 10 min、复温、停机时分别测定血气、血钾、血钙。结果 :心跳组转机中流量、平均动脉压、转中尿量均较心停组高 ,而转流时间却较短 ,两组比较有显著性差异 (P<0 .0 5 )。 BH组与 AH组比较 ,p H值、PO2 、BE值较转机前有显著升高 ,而 PCO2 却有显著下降 (P<0 .0 5 ) ,接近于正常生理值 ,两组 Hct在转前、转中变化无明显差异 ,血钾、血钙在 BH组中较稳定。结论 :心脏不停跳体外循环比心脏停跳体外循环更接近正常生理状态 ,能保持良好的有氧代谢。Objective: To study the effects on the plasma electrolyte and acid base balance by CPB with beating heart or arrested heart. Methods:Ninety three patients scheduled to undergo valve replacement open heart surgery,were randomly assigned to two groups: forty seven cases received beating heart CPB (BH group) and forty six cases received arrested heart CPB(AH group).The average BP, CVP, urine volume and nasopharyngeal temperatures in CPB were measured.The changes of blood gas,the concentration of blood kalium and blood calcium were observed before CPB, 10 minutes in CPB,rewarming and after CPB,respectively. Results: In CPB, the flow of perfusion,average BP, urine volume in group BH were significantly higher than that in group AH ( P <0 05), the time of CPB in group BH was significantly shorter than that in group AH( P <0 05); PH, PO 2, and BE raised significantly, PCO 2 decreased significantly to restored the levels of the physiologic value in group BH during CPB ( P <0 05).There were not difference before CPB and during CPB in the two groups on HCT( P >0 05).The concentrations of blood kalium and blood calcium stabilized in group BH during CPB( P >0 05). Conclusion:Beating heart CPB is more approach the normal physiologic state than arrested heart CPB, and maintains a better oxygen consumption,acid base balance and electrolyte metabolism.
